Absolutely loving the Pixel 2 experience. The camera has really shone and glad I got it for the holidays as managed to snap some great family time memories. As has been mentioned a few times on the thread most people who receive the images are impressed/flattered by the image of them or the shot taken. It isn't perfect nor will it replace my camera gear but it is great to snap memories and make me want to shoot more. I think I shot more with the Pixel in a short space of time than any other smartphone as the images can be easily printed or converted to a photobook and keep a decent quality.

The battery on the smaller device which I was worried about wasn't a factor either. I hammered the camera and video and replied to various messages and searched for the sales and had enough juice at the end of the day. I wouldn't mind the XL battery to get me through a another half day but will just charge nightly as before but not have to worry will it get me through the day.

The screen has been crisp and size perfect.

My only negative so far is no face detection in camera mode and the video is a bit shocking when compared to the photo side. The video has a slight judder to it and even when shooting 4k and beaming to my TV it wasn't as impressive as I thought it would be. It doesn't shift in auto mode to the lighting of the scene and focus can be a bit iffy. The OIS is pretty decent though but will tinker more with video but hoping it improves over time with a software update.

I appreciate these might be a little above what you were planning to spend but I got the Apple AirPods for Christmas for my 2XL and they have been excellent so far. I said I'd report back on my findings so here I am.
With the addition of the AirPods for GA app on the Play Store they work just as they would with an iPhone - the only feature that doesn't work is the automatic pause when you remove one of the buds from your ear but I'm not even sure I'd want this. They play/pause music and launch Google Assistant without a hitch. I should point out that I also have a MacBook so I am getting a little more value out of them that way, if I didn't have it I couldn't in all honesty declare I'd still have got them but they are great and I do like the 'no wires' aspect which is what put me off the pixel buds or even the Jaybirds, if I want wireless earphones they are going to be wireless.
